    Radiator Supply Tank Cap

    For a 1964 365 hp. no Air Cond. where can I find a original Radiator Supply tank cap. What should it read on top. is it made out of Stainless. does it have a date code on it.

    I have a cap that I believe is from a AC car. 15lb RC 15 in a circle. AC circle on the left side. Says Inspect Fall & Spring, Stainless. I believe it is an original.

    Re: Radiator Supply Tank Cap

    In spite of what some ebay sellers will have you believe, any radiator cap (or supply tank cap) marked STAINLESS didn't exist until after 1972. I'm not sure exactly when the stainless caps came into existence, but I am absolutely sure it is newer than 1972. Someone else will be able to supply the complete history, but at some point in the 1970s the stainless cap became the SERVICE replacement for the RC 15 cap.

    A frequent poster to this board wrote a story on the RC15 cap for The Corvette Restorer -- see V32 #3, Winter 2006, page 18 for pictures of what a vintage RC15 looks like.

      Re: Radiator Supply Tank Cap

      I believe your original cap would have been a 307 at 13lb. The normal vendors do sell repros. An original will be hard to find and quite expensive. There is one currently listed on ebay. It does appear to be an original, but others may be better able to authenticate.

        Re: Radiator Supply Tank Cap 13lb

        Check out Restorer Article, author may have a source of cap for you.
        The 307/13 is the correct cap however not the 15. The ebay one looks good. As mentioned others may be better able to authenticate it.

          Re: Radiator Supply Tank Cap 13lb

          I'd suggest that the 13# cap on eBay looks correct, but it's kinda rough on top. I'd like better pictures, or to hold it in my hand.

          There are reasonable reproductions from at least one, possibly two, companies that will cost you about 12% of his listing price and only lose 1 point.

                Re: Source For Best Repro?

                Paragon has a zinc-plated 307/13; DeWitt's has one too, but his catalog doesn't say what the finish is.

                  Re: Source For Best Repro?

                  Up until recently, DeWitt sold the same zinc plated one as Paragon and almost everyone else. I think Tom's changing his source on at least one version of his radiator caps to a more correct one.
